Metro Transit

The Metropolitan Council operates Metro Transit, the region's largest bus system. There are several local routes that serve New Hope (see map) as well as express bus service to downtown Minneapolis.

A Park and Ride facility is also conveniently located for New Hope residents at 63rd and Bottineau Boulevard (West Broadway)

Five Cities Senior Transportation

Five Cities Transportation provides bus transportation for residents age 60 plus from New Hope and several surrounding communities. The service travels from your home or apartment complex to city sponsored activities, social service programs, congregate dining, and shopping locations such as Cub, Ridgedale, Target and Walmart.

Bimonthly schedules list dates and destinations. Schedules are available at the Recreation office or by following the link below. The fare is $5 cash per round trip or $4 with a punch card (available for $16 or $32). Passes can be purchased from the bus drivers. Special Destination fares are two punches from the punch pass or $8 cash.

Metro Mobility

Metro Mobility serves people who need specially-equipped vehicles for transportation, including vehicles with lift equipment. The service is available on request to seniors in the Twin Cities area.
